The 35-year-old model has four children – Sophia, nine, Liberty, five, Johnny, three and Jack, 22 months – with her husband Peter Crouch and has said every one of her pregnancies left her feeling “so ill”, as well as battling with skin allergies and hair loss.

And Abbey also admitted seeing “clumps of hair fall out” was so “damaging” to her confidence that it made her feel scared about the prospect of losing all her hair.

She said: “'I was so ill during pregnancy, and my skin was so reactive. It was allergic to everything, even fabrics and washing powder. I also had a lot of hair loss.

“It grows back, but when clumps of hair fall out when you're washing it, it's terrifying. I had three kids in four years, so I felt like I had no hair left by the end! It's another thing that was damaging to my confidence. It's scary for any woman going through that.”

Abbey also suffers from pigmentation which can cause discoloured patches of skin on the body and face, and said she first noticed the condition when she was pregnant with her first child, Sophia.

She added: "I've been struggling with pigmentation for about 10 years now - it began when I was pregnant with my first daughter, Sophia.

"It was quite damaging to my self-confidence - I felt I always had to wear make-up to cover it up - so I'm always on the lookout for products that can help combat that."
